Interest Determination. The Borrower shall pay interest on the principal of each Tranche from time to time outstanding during each Interest Period at the Fixed Interest Rate/Floating Interest Rate specified in the applicable Disbursement Notice. Interest shall (i) accrue from and including the first day of the Interest Period to but excluding the last day of such Interest Period; and (ii) be due and payable on the Interest Payment Dates specified in the applicable Disbursement Notice. Interest shall be calculated on the basis of the Day Count Convention specified in the relevant Disbursement Notice. In the case of Floating Interest Rate Tranches, the CEB shall determine on each Interest Determination Date the interest rate applicable during the relevant Interest Period in accordance with the Agreement and promptly give notice thereof to the Borrower. Each determination by the CEB shall be final, conclusive and binding upon the Borrower unless shown by the Borrower to the satisfaction of the CEB that any such determination has involved manifest error.

Default Interest Rate In the event that the Borrower fails to pay, in full or in part, any amount under the Agreement, and notwithstanding any other recourse available to the CEB under the Agreement or otherwise, the Borrower shall pay interest on such unpaid amounts from the due date until the date of receipt of such payment by the CEB at the interest rate per annum equal to the one-month EURIBOR quoted on the due date plus two hundred basis points (200 bps) (hereinafter, the “Default Interest Rate”). The applicable Default Interest Rate shall be updated every thirty (30) calendar days. Market Disruption Event The CEB shall promptly, upon becoming aware of it, notify to the Borrower that a Market Disruption Event has occurred. For the purposes of the Agreement, “Market Disruption Event” refers to the following circumstances: The relevant financial news provider referred to under the EURIBOR definition does not quote any percentage rate or its corresponding screen rate page is not accessible.
